Skills and Experience:
- Industrial commissioning and/or field service engineering experience; fault finding of mechanical/electrical and instrumentation such as compressors, valves, control systems and motors.
- Knowledge of PLCs, control system fault finding and basics of process control.
- Ability to work independently with strong diagnostic skills.
- Strong knowledge and experience of working in high-risk environments and associated safe systems of work.
- Experience working in gas processing highly desirable.
Role and Responsibilities:
- Develop and improve commissioning and handover procedures and documentation.
- Develop method statements, risk assessments and procedures for commissioning and maintenance.
- Perform SAT and commissioning of skids at customer sites including green-lining drawings.
- Provide remote and in person support (call outs) to customers in fault finding, diagnosing issues and production optimisation.
- Plan and execute planned and corrective maintenance at customer sites and provide service reports.
- Provide input to continuous improvement of the design and construction of equipment.
- Provide product/equipment training to third party stakeholders, including customers and sub-contractors.
The Opportunity:
My client working within the renewables sector are looking for a Commissioning and Maintenance Engineer on a permanent basis. The purpose of this role is to help with the commission and handover of biomethane upgrading and other related products at customer sites and provide ongoing maintenance across the UK.
You must have a full UK driving licence and be able to travel across the country as my client needs someone who can commission sites and ensure steady-state gas production. The successful candidate will also perform call-out support and hyper care to customer deployments.
